The Marshall is a three screen cinema located in the heart of Marshall, Mo. operated by B & B Theatres.

It is a very well appointed and comfortable theatre even though it is small. The auditoriums are boxy but have good site lines and feature Dolby Surround sound in each.

It features first run attractions and has a full snack bar and game room.

Perhaps another auditorium was added, but based on the pictures of the marquee above and the one of it in this article, the theater appears to be a twin. B&B Theatres is closing this theater in Augist, 2010: http://www.marshallnews.com/story/1652138.html

Although the theater’s closing was announced by B&B Theatres in July, it will only be temporary. The theater shall reopen in October after renovations: http://www.marshallnews.com/story/1654456.html

I have never been inside this theatre, but have driven past it. If I recall correctly, the entrance to the 3rd auditorium is actually around the corner from the main entrance, and faces the side street. The entrance to the 1st and 2nd auditoriums are inside the front entrance, as shown in the photo above.
